Detailed description of the invention
Below in conjunction with drawings and Examples, the utility model is further illustrated.
As shown in Figure 1, for meeting a kind of food market of the present utility model bulky refuse processor 100, it comprises: conveyer 1 and the processor 2 being connected with conveyer 1.
Described conveyer 1 has feed hopper 11 and is arranged on the object inductive switch 12 of feed hopper 11 bottoms.Described conveyer 1 also comprises the conveyer belt 13 being connected between processor 2 and feed hopper 11, described conveyer belt 13 both sides are also provided with metal inductive probe 14, when conveyer 1 has metallic objects find rubbish in conveying garbage process in, conveyer 1 can stop carrying automatically.
Described processor 2 comprises case box 20, be arranged on first crush box 21 on case box 20 tops, be arranged on the first crush box 21 tops hydraulic stem 211, be arranged on the first crush box 21 inwall centre position places object inductive switch 212, be arranged on the first crush box 21 bottoms reducing mechanism, be arranged on first of the first crush box 21 outsides and pulverize motor 214.Described first pulverizes motor 214 and shatters that device 2131,2132 is connected and for driving the rotation that shatters device 2131,2132.Described reducing mechanism 2131,2132 comprises that first of stacked on top shatters device 2131 and second and shatters device 2132.Described the first reducing mechanism 2131 is provided with a pair of relatively inwardly rotating shaft (not label) and is arranged on upper also cross one another two the sharp cone distal teeth (not label) of a pair of relatively inwardly rotating shaft (not label).Described the second reducing mechanism 2132 is provided with a pair of relatively inwardly rotating shaft and is arranged on a pair of relatively inwardly rotating shaft and cross one another two sharp cone distal teeth.
Described processor 2 also comprises that being arranged on first shatters second of case 21 downsides and shatter case 22 and be positioned at second and shatter the 3rd of case 22 downsides and shatter case 23, described second shatters in case 22 and is provided with hydraulic push rod 221,222, in described the 3rd crush box 23, is provided with horizontal blade 231 and rotating shaft 232.Described processor 2 also comprises and the 3rd shatters motor 233 for what drive that the horizontal blade 231 of the 3rd crush box 23 rotates.Described hydraulic push rod 221,222 comprises and is arranged on the second left hydraulic push rod 221 and right hydraulic push rod 222 that shatters the left and right sides in case 22.Described hydraulic push rod 221,222 the insides are provided with O type circle and hole flushing brush.
First the total power switch outside processor 2 is opened, and rubbish drops into the feed hopper 11 of conveyer, and object inductive switch 12 senses object, and conveyer 1 starts to start, and feed hopper 11 rubbish are along with the startup of conveyer 1, and rubbish is input into the first crush box 21.Rubbish is transported to the certain altitude of 21 li of the first crush boxs, object inductive switch 212 can quit work conveyer 1, first pulverizes motor 214 starts working, the first crush box 21 hydraulic stem 211 above starts to pressing down, and hydraulic stem 211 can depress to the first reducing mechanism 2131 and second rubbish and shatter device 2132.The rubbish of the first crush box 21 is pressed onto while thering is no rubbish and can stops by hydraulic stem 211, stop after hydraulic stem 211 start to rise, the conveyer 1 that puts in place of rising is started working again.The powder of the rubbish of the first crush box 21 after the first reducing mechanism 2131 and second shatters device 2132 cuttings enters to second and shatters case 22, the second hydraulic push rod shattering in case 22 is started working, left hydraulic push rod 221 is pushed right side to entering powder, the moisture that left hydraulic push rod 221 is shifted onto in powder can not arrhea, moisture in powder can shatter case 22 second and flow out, and second shatters case has discharge orifice 225 22 times.The second left hydraulic push rod 221 shattering in case 22 is the same at the pressure arrheaing with the pressure of right hydraulic push rod 222.Left hydraulic push rod 221 water that powder flows out in the process of arrheaing enters the second discharge orifice 225 that shatters case 22, left hydraulic push rod 221 is arrheaing rear left hydraulic push rod 221 pressure increases, left hydraulic push rod 221 continues to advance to the right, right hydraulic push rod 222 at this time pressure not to after-contraction, the second garbage outlet door 226 that shatters case 22 right sides is opened, until powder is fallen into the 3rd crush box 23.Left hydraulic push rod 221 starts to after-contraction, the hole flushing brush handle that to after-contraction time, left hydraulic push rod 221 is installed presses the second discharge orifice 225 that shatters case 22 to brush, prevent that the second discharge orifice 225 that shatters case 22 from blocking, left hydraulic push rod 221 is to after-contraction simultaneously, right hydraulic push rod 222 is also pushed ahead, and shifts the second garbage outlet door 226 that shatters case 22 right sides onto and closes.Powder cake enters the 3rd crush box 23, the three crush boxs 23 the 3rd connected motors 233 and starts working, and powder cake is ground into powder again and flows into powder case 24, and laterally 231 sharp cone distal tooth quick rotation of blade are in layer pulverized powder cake.
